Nutrition and Cognitive Performance

Diet plays a critical role in supporting and optimizing brain function. The brain requires a steady supply of nutrients to operate optimally, and certain dietary options have been proven to enhance brain health and memory. Including a diet abundant in antioxidants, beneficial fats, vitamins, and minerals can enhance cognitive performance. Items such as fatty fish, nuts, berries, as well as leafy greens provide essential nutrients that help reduce swelling and oxidative stress, which are detrimental to brain health.
Furthermore, the relationship between gut health and brain function is increasingly acknowledged. A varied gut microbiome can enhance the absorption of essential elements that favorably impact cognitive abilities. Foods high in probiotics, such as yogurt and fermented vegetables, can encourage a healthy gut environment, creating a link between what we eat and how our brain functions. This connection underscores the importance of a balanced diet for both physical and mental well-being.
Water intake is another often-overlooked aspect of diet that significantly affects brain function. Even mild dehydration can impair focus, memory, as well as overall cognitive performance. Consuming adequate amounts of water throughout the daytime ensures that the brain remains hydrated, enabling optimal neurotransmitter function and communication between brain cells. Adding brain-boosting foods combined with proper hydration can create a strong foundation for mental clarity and improved cognitive abilities.
